Does anyone know what the diamond on a tape measure at about 19 7/32ths is for? It's a direct division of 8' by 5-- but why would anyone need to that?

As dominion says, alternate spacing for supports that are needed for a loading between those provided by 16"(6) & 24"(4)
for 5 supports 20" is too much, hence 19.2" there should be one every multiple of 19.2 inches - 38.4, 57.6, 76.8 etc.
